Resources for seniors in Boise, ID
El-Ada CAP - Boise Food Pantry, located in Boise, Idaho, provides essential food assistance to low-income individuals and families. Operating Monday through Thursday from 7 a.m. to 5:30 p.m., the pantry offers vital resources through two key programs. Low-income seniors are eligible to receive a food box every 60 days via the Community Services Block Grant (CSBG) program, with each box typically containing enough food to last for 2 to 4 days. Additionally, the Emergency Food Assistance Program (TEFAP) supplies eligible locals with pantry staples such as dried and canned goods once a month. To qualify for either program, household incomes must not exceed 200% of the federal poverty level. For more information, individuals can contact the pantry at (208) 377-0700.
Metro Meals on Wheels is a dedicated volunteer organization based in Boise, ID, that provides essential meal delivery services to homebound seniors throughout Ada County. Catering to individuals aged 60 and over who are unable to prepare meals for themselves, Metro Meals on Wheels ensures that eligible seniors receive nutritious meals seven days a week. In addition to delivering meals directly to homes, the organization also offers daily congregate meals at local senior centers, fostering community engagement and support for those participating in activities there. While a donation is requested for each meal provided, Metro Meals on Wheels emphasizes their commitment to inclusivity by ensuring that no one is turned away due to financial constraints. For more information or assistance, they can be reached at (208) 321-0031.

The Idaho Emergency Food Assistance Program (TEFAP) operates in Boise, ID, providing essential food support to low-income seniors and other eligible residents of the state. Collaborating with the United States Department of Agriculture, the program aims to alleviate food insecurity by delivering resources through local Emergency Feeding Organizations, including food banks, soup kitchens, and pantries. To qualify for assistance, applicants must demonstrate an income at or below 250% of the federal poverty line. It is important for potential participants to note that individual local agencies may have specific documentation requirements for enrollment. For more information, interested individuals can contact TEFAP at (208) 375-7382.
The Idaho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P), located in Boise, ID, is dedicated to assisting seniors and low-income families in accessing nutritious food. Formerly referred to as food stamps, this program provides eligible participants with an electronic benefits transfer card, which is preloaded with funds for purchasing a variety of approved food items such as bread, cereals, fruits, vegetables, meat, fish, poultry, and dairy products. Eligibility for SNAP is determined by factors including residency status, income level, and assets. For those who qualify, immediate food assistance can be provided within seven days of application. For more information or assistance, individuals can contact the program at (877) 456-1233.

The Idaho Section 504 Repair Program, located in Boise, ID, offers essential assistance for single-family housing repairs through loans and grants provided by the U.S. Department of Agriculture. Specifically designed for rural areas in Idaho, the program provides low-interest loans of up to $40,000 to eligible homeowners. Additionally, individuals aged 62 and older may qualify for a grant of up to $10,000, allowing them to combine both funding options and access a total of $50,000 for necessary home repairs. This initiative aims to improve living conditions and support the needs of residents in rural communities. For more information or assistance, interested parties can contact the program at (800) 292-8293.

The Property Tax Reduction program, commonly referred to as the Circuit Breaker program, is offered by the Ada County Assessor's Office in Boise, ID. This initiative aims to alleviate the financial burden of property taxes for eligible homeowners, providing reductions of up to $1,500 based on income. Additionally, Idaho features a property tax deferral program that enables participants to defer their property taxes on up to one acre of land. It is important to note that these deferred taxes must be settled when the ownership of the property changes or if it no longer meets the qualifications for deferral. For more information, interested individuals can contact the Ada County Assessor’s Office at (208) 287-7200.

Considerations for seniors living in Boise, ID
Outdoor Activities: Boise has plenty of opportunities for outdoor activities like hiking, skiing, and rafting thanks to its proximity to the Rocky Mountains. Seniors can enjoy these activities with local groups or on their own.
Healthcare Facilities: Boise is home to several well-regarded medical facilities and hospitals, including St. Luke's Hospital and the Boise VA Medical Center.
Low Crime Rates: Boise has relatively low crime rates compared to other US cities of similar size, which can be reassuring for seniors concerned about safety.
Affordable Living: Despite its growing popularity in recent years, Boise remains one of the most affordable cities in the western United States, making it an excellent option for seniors looking for a lower cost-of-living.
Active Community: Boise is known for being a friendly and vibrant community with plenty of events and activities geared toward older adults such as senior centers with exercise classes, book clubs, game nights etc., offering opportunities to socialize and stay active.
Accessible Transportation: Public transportation is available through ValleyRide Bus System, making getting around easy even if driving isn't an option for seniors.
Rich Cultural Scene: From museums and galleries to live music venues and theaters, there are many cultural activities in Boise that seniors can enjoy regularly throughout the year.
Great Weather: With four distinct seasons but mild winters, Boise offers a comfortable climate ideal for enjoying outdoor activities without risking extreme weather conditions typically seen in other regions across the US.
